4. Web 2.0 - The Web as
Participation/Internet Democracy
"Web 2.0 refers to web development and
web design that facilitates interactive
information sharing, user-centered
design and collaboration on the World
Wide Web.
Examples of Web 2.0 include web-based
communities, web applications, social-
networking sites, video-sharing sites,
wikis, blogs.
A Web 2.0 site allows its users to
interact with other users or to change
website content, in contrast to non-
interactive websites where users are
limited to the passive viewing of
information that is provided to them."

6. PC Magazine defines a Social Network as:
"An association of people drawn together by family, work or hobby. The term
was first coined by professor J. A. Barnes in the 1950s, who defined the size
of a social network as a group of about 100 to 150 people."
And defines a Social Networking Site as:
"A Web site that provides a virtual community for people interested in a
particular subject or just to 'hang out' together.
Members create their own online "profile" with biographical data, pictures,
likes, dislikes and any other information they choose to post.
The 'social networking site' is the 21st century 'virtual community,' a group of
people who use the Internet to communicate with each other about anything
and everything.
7. Introduced in 2002, Friendster
(www.friendster.com) was the first social
site, followed by MySpace
(www.myspace.com) a year later.
Started by two friends, MySpace became
extremely popular, and its parent
company, was acquired by News
Corporation for $580 million two years
after MySpace was launched.
Facebook (www.facebook.com) came out
in 2004 initially targeting college
students, but later welcoming everyone .

12. FACEBOOK
Launched in 2004 by Mark Zuckerberg and co-founders Dustin Moskovitz, Chris
Hughes and Eduardo Saverin launch Facebook from their Harvard dorm room.
Facebook was originally intended to connect university students but quickly
spread throughout the confines of campuses and now is the world's largest
social networking site.
According to its :
"Facebook's mission is to give people the power to share and make the world
more open and connected.
"Millions of people use Facebook everyday to keep up with friends, upload an
unlimited number of photos, share links and videos, and learn more about the
people they meet."

21. del.icio.us - www.delicious.com
What is social bookmarking?
"Social bookmarking is a method for Internet users to store, organize, search,
and manage bookmarks of web pages on the Internet with the help of
metadata, typically in the form of tags that collectively and/or
collaboratively become a folksonomy. Folksonomy is also called social
tagging, "the process by which many users add metadata in the form of
keywords to shared content".
What is Delicious?
Delicious is a social bookmarking service that allows users to tag, save,
manage and share web pages from a centralized source.
Things you can do with Delicious
• Bookmark any site on the Internet, and get to it from anywhere
• Share your bookmarks, and get bookmarks in return.
22. Wikipedia is a free, web-based, collaborative,
multilingual encyclopedia project supported by the
non-profit Wikimedia Foundation.
Its 18 million articles (over 3.5 million in English) have
been written collaboratively by volunteers around the
world.
Wikipedia was launched in 2001 by Jimmy Wales and
Larry Sanger and has become the largest and most
popular general reference work on the Internet.
The name Wikipedia was coined by Larry Sanger and is a portmanteau of wiki
(a technology for creating collaborative websites, from the Hawaiian word
wiki, meaning "quick") and encyclopedia.
